Hamiltonian formalism of fractional systems
In this paper we consider a generalized classical mechanics with fractional
derivatives. The generalization is based on the time-clock randomization of
momenta and coordinates taken from the conventional phase space. The fractional
equations of motion are derived using the Hamiltonian formalism. The approach
is illustrated with a simple-fractional oscillator in a free state and under an
external force. Besides the behavior of the coupled fractional oscillators is
analyzed. The natural extension of this approach to continuous systems is
